Most F&B assets don't fail loudly — they leak. An operator's reports arrive late, then thin, then not at all. Budgets drift. Deferred maintenance compounds. The lease says one thing and the P&L says another, and by the time ownership sees the problem, it's a year old and twice the size. Operators run the day-to-day; almost nobody represents the owner. How we work
Onboard. Deep review of agreements, budgets, and historical performance — and a reporting baseline ownership can trust.
Set the standard. KPIs, budgets, and performance triggers agreed with ownership and the operator, in writing, before the first review cycle.
Oversee. Monthly reporting and P&L reviews, regular operator sessions, and site visits that verify what the numbers claim.
Intervene. When performance drifts, we diagnose the cause, direct a corrective plan, and see it through — support first, accountability always.
Grow value. Annual planning, capital prioritization, and repositioning strategy that treats the venue as what it is: a real estate asset with a return to protect.
